From 70d572d93ad370673d53aa4b9267761e6a461f68 Mon Sep 17 00:00:00 2001 From: Infi Date: Wed, 5 Jun 2024 17:22:16 +0200 Subject: [PATCH] feat: animate message content size change Signed-off-by: Infi --- app/src/main/java/chat/revolt/components/chat/Message.kt |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/app/src/main/java/chat/revolt/components/chat/Message.kt b/app/src/main/java/chat/revolt/components/chat/Message.kt index eb7bb890..e65acc43 100644 --- a/app/src/main/java/chat/revolt/components/chat/Message.kt +++ b/app/src/main/java/chat/revolt/components/chat/Message.kt @@ -8,6 +8,7 @@ import android.widget.Toast import androidx.activity.compose.rememberLauncherForActivityResult import androidx.activity.result.contract.ActivityResultContracts import androidx.browser.customtabs.CustomTabsIntent +import androidx.compose.animation.animateContentSize import androidx.compose.foundation.ExperimentalFoundationApi import androidx.compose.foundation.background import androidx.compose.foundation.clickable @@ -186,7 +187,7 @@ fun Message( val authorIsBlocked = remember(author) { author.relationship == "Blocked" } - Column { + Column(Modifier.animateContentSize()) { if (message.tail == false) { Spacer(modifier = Modifier.height(10.dp)) }